Gå til innhold
Trenger du hjelp med internett og nettverk? Still spørsmål her ×

MYSQL


Anbefalte innlegg

Hallo!

 

Eg holder på å lage ein internettside, og eg har tenkt å ha eit forum på det!

Eg har sett på phpbb sitt forum. der står det at eg treng mysql. Eg skjøner ikkje kva dette er. Så kan noken forklara ka dette er og kva som må til for at eg skal kunne bruke det? Og treng eg eit web-hotell for å ha eit forum?

 

Eg har tenkt å få eit .com domene frå domeneshop.

Lenke til kommentar
Videoannonse
Annonse
Hallo!

 

Eg holder på å lage ein internettside, og eg har tenkt å ha eit forum på det!

Eg har sett på phpbb sitt forum. der står det at eg treng mysql. Eg skjøner ikkje kva dette er. Så kan noken forklara ka dette er og kva som må til for at eg skal kunne bruke det? Og treng eg eit web-hotell for å ha eit forum?

 

Eg har tenkt å få eit .com domene frå domeneshop.

mysql er en gratis relasjonsdatabase. se www.mysql.com

Lenke til kommentar

Vel, du må jo først finne ut om du trenger mysql. Vet du noe om databaser? Hørt om Oracle? Både Oracle og Mysql er databasesystemer og med mindre du virkelig ikke har bruk for det så er det ingen vits i å tenke på det. Ganske mye å sette seg inn i dersom du ikke kan noe som helst fra før. Dersom du har adsl og pleier å ha pc´en din på 24/7 eller har muligheten til det så burde du sette opp en web-serve og da trenger du ikke å tenke på noe web-hotell. Da kjøres og lagres alt lokalt på din pc.

 

X.

Lenke til kommentar

MySQL er som ovenfor nevnt en datatbaseserver. Når den omtales som "gratis" betyr det at du fritt kan laste den ned og bruke den, men hvis du leier plass på et webhotel tar de fleste ekstra betalt for tilgang til en MySQL-server.

 

Hvis du ikke skal sette opp ting og tang selv er det ikke så vanskelig. De fleste webhotelleverandører lar deg bruke et browserbasert grensesnitt som lar deg peke og klikke for å opprette tabeller ol. Eventuelt kan du bruke et forumscript som oppretter alt det trenger på egenhånd.

 

For øvrig: Du trenger ikke et webhotell for å ha et forum, men du trenger en webserver som kjører PHP, ASP, JSP eller har mulighet for CGI. (PHP anbefales: gratis og svært kraftig.) Dette kan du fint konfigurere på din egen webserver hvis du har litt tid og/eller peiling. Men det enkleste er å betale 50-150 kr/mnd og leie plass på et webhotell.

 

 

 

Siden du spør antar jeg du er litt blank på disse tingene, så en nærmere forklaring er kanskje på sin plass. En vanlig HTML-side er lik hver gang den sendes ut. Altså trenger du bare en server som leser filen fra disk og sender den av gårde. Hvis du skal ha et forum vil sidene forandres hele tiden, og brukere sender flere data til serveren enn den vanlige "send meg fil ettellerannet.html" -melldingen. Altså må du ha et eller annet program på serveren som behandler innkommende data og setter sammen sidene som skal sendes til den som leser siden din. Dette kalles server side scripting, og kan gjøres på flere måter.

 

Den vanligste måten tidligere var å skrive et program som skrev ut de aktuelle sidene. Dette kompilerte du og la i en egen cgi-mappe på webserveren. Når Webserveren får beskjed om å vise en fil fra cgi-mappen vet den at den ikke skal sende ut selve filen, men kjøre den og sende resultatet som returneres.

 

De senere årene er det blitt mer og mer populært å bruke egne scriptingspråk som PHP og ASP. Dette funker nesten på samme måten, men i stedet for en kompilert programfil som kjøres er det et script som leses og tolkes i sanntid. Resultatet sendes til brukeren som html. For å få til dette må webserveren være utstyrt med en egen modul som tar seg av dette. I praksis er ikke den ene metoden nødvendigvis "bedre" enn den andre, men PHP er nok det enkeste å lære.

Lenke til kommentar

PHPBB-forumene KREVER PHP/MySQL støtte, dvs du MÅ ha det.

 

Det du gjør er å skaffer deg en gammel pc, med en 133mhz, 64mb ram, og en 5gb hdd (eller mer/bedre). Slenger inn FreeBSD. Det kan ikke være enklere å sette opp webserver med støtte for PHP og MySQL enn i FreeBSD. Om du følger mitt råd skal jeg gjerne veilede deg, og fortelle deg hvordan du får innstalert PHP/MySQL. Men selve inntstalasjonen av OS'et får du klare selv. www.freebsd.org/handbook er jo en god start.

 

Om dette høres kjipern ut, kan du jo bare kjøpe ett webhotell på domeneshop med det samme du kjøper domene!

Lenke til kommentar

Takk for svara.

 

Eg har skjekka dette med webhotell, og eg ser at det står at MYSQL er innkludert.

Korleis skal eg konfigurere det slik at forumet virker? Eg tvilar på at det berre er å laste opp forumet, så korleis gjer eg det?

Lenke til kommentar

PHP-filer er bare å laste opp, så funker det. Hvis serveren har installert PHP da, det har de aller fleste.

 

Som andre skriver, webhotell lever vanligvis med phpMyAdmin som gjør at du enkelt kan opprette databasen din over web. Så er det bare å fylle inn databaseopplysningen i PHP-filene. Dette er godt forklart i den vedlagte dokumentasjonen.

Lenke til kommentar
Eg har skjekka dette med webhotell, og eg ser at det står at MYSQL er innkludert.

Korleis skal eg konfigurere det slik at forumet virker? Eg tvilar på at det berre er å laste opp forumet, så korleis gjer eg det?

 

Som det står over så kan du bruke PhpMyAdmin som er ett kjekt program for redigering/oppretting/slettering etc. av databaser og tabeller. PHPBB-forumene krever en database (ikke for seg selv). Men phpbb har en bra manual som forklarer dette ;)

Lenke til kommentar

Hvis du er helt blank på SQL, PHP og slikt og du vil ha et forum ut på web anbefaler jeg at du benytter deg av en webhost som tilbyr Kontrollpanel med "Fantastico" - det lar deg automatisk installere PHPBB og andre forum uten å ha noe kunnskap om SQL eller PHP.

 

Eneste jeg vet om i Norge som tilbyr Fantastico i sine webpakker er disse folka her.

 

I USA finnes det en rekke som tilbyr webhosting med Fantastico. Søk på Google og du vil finne en rekke hosting leverandører.

 

Kristoffer

Lenke til kommentar
Hvis du er helt blank på SQL, PHP og slikt og du vil ha et forum ut på web anbefaler jeg at du benytter deg av en webhost som tilbyr Kontrollpanel med "Fantastico" - det lar deg automatisk installere PHPBB og andre forum uten å ha noe kunnskap om SQL eller PHP.

 

Eneste jeg vet om i Norge som tilbyr Fantastico i sine webpakker er disse folka her.

 

I USA finnes det en rekke som tilbyr webhosting med Fantastico. Søk på Google og du vil finne en rekke hosting leverandører.

 

Kristoffer

Tusen takk!

 

Det var akkuratt noke slikt eg var ute etter.

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...